GitLab CI-为CI / CD设置GitLab Runner

时间:2018-08-22 19:48:00

标签: gitlab

我正在另一个服务器系统上设置GitLab Runner。我在注册步骤中遇到错误。错误消息为“网络出现问题”。

该错误的详细描述是 “错误:正在注册跑步者……失败。无法针对http://gitlab.sw.st执行POST ratus.com/api/v4/runners:发布http://gitlab.sw.stratus.com/api/v4/runners:拨号 tcp 134.111.200.59:80:connectex:连接尝试失败,因为一段时间后被连接方未正确响应,或者建立连接失败,因为连接的主机未响应。”

问题是我尝试在其上设置GitLab Runner的服务器系统使用端口80与Apache服务器进行通信。有什么办法可以使GitLab Runner在80以外的任何其他端口上拨号连接?

关于, Poornima

1 个答案:

答案 0 :(得分:0)

您应该在Runner配置中修改advertise_addresslisten_address

[session_server]
  listen_address = "0.0.0.0:8093"
  advertise_address = "gitlab.com:8093"

Check here获取完整的文档。